Academy Announces New AI Rules for the Oscars

In an effort to keep up with the ever-changing landscape of filmmaking, the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ences has announced new rules for the Oscars involving the use of artificial intelligence. The rules, which will go into effect immediately, aim to ensure that AI technology is used ethically and responsibly in the filmmaking process.

According to the guidelines set by the Academy, any film submitted for consideration for an Oscar must disclose if AI was used in any aspect of its production. Additionally, filmmakers are required to provide a detailed explanation of how AI was utilized and how it impacted the final product.

Trump Announces 25% Tariffs on Cars, Leading to Potential Price Increases

In a shocking move, President Trump has announced a 25% tariff on cars imported into the United States, a decision that could have far-reaching consequences for consumers and the auto industry. The tariffs, which will affect vehicles from major manufacturers such as GM, Ford, and Stellantis, are set to be implemented in the coming months.

This announcement has sent shockwaves through the industry, with experts predicting that the tariffs will lead to significant price increases for American consumers. While the Trump administration has argued that these tariffs are necessary to protect American jobs and combat unfair trade practices, critics have warned that they will only serve to harm the economy.

The news has sparked outrage among industry leaders, with many expressing concern about the impact on sales and production. Automakers have warned that the tariffs could lead to layoffs and plant closures, further exacerbating the economic fallout from the COVID-19 pandemic.

Trump Announces Controversial Tariffs on Steel and Aluminum

In a bold move that has sent shockwaves through the global economy, President Trump announced yesterday his decision to impose hefty tariffs on steel and aluminum imports. The move, which aims to protect American industries, has sparked fears of a trade war with major trading partners such as China and the EU.

According to reports, the tariffs will be set at 25% for steel imports and 10% for aluminum imports, a move that has been met with criticism from both domestic and international stakeholders. While Trump has justified the tariffs as a necessary measure to safeguard American jobs, many economists argue that they will only serve to harm the economy in the long run.
